24/7 Crisis Number for Children and Young People - Updated
Please be advised that the 24/7 Crisis Number for children and young people has changed.
“For urgent calls for children and young people who are experiencing a mental health crisis contact the Rise Crisis team between 8am- 8pm on 02476 641799 or call 0300 200 0011 outside of these hours. During the COVID response, this is service is available 24-hours a day, 7-days a week, with an advice-only service outside the core hours of 8am-8pm.”
